Located in a pleasant rural road just outside the picturesque village of Bletchingley this charming medieval village offers shops, a number of excellent gastro pubs and a golf club. Fast train services to London and a more comprehensive range of shops can be found in the nearby towns of Redhill (3.4 miles), Caterham (2.8 miles), and Oxted, approximately 6 miles away. This area is also served by good local state and private schools.

Junction 6 is approximately 4 miles away providing easy access to the M25 and Gatwick airport. Redhill mainline railway station provides fast trains to East Croydon (from 16 minutes) London Bridge (31 minutes) London Victoria (from 37minutes) and London St Pancras (from 46 minutes). In addition Merstham mainline station provides fast trains to London Bridge (from 27 minutes) and London Victoria (from 33 minutes)
